Install localization package
|
||||
============================
|
||||
|
||||
A country-specific localization module :ref:`must be installed <general/install>` to properly
|
||||
configure and process payroll. To install the required module, first open the **Apps** app.
|
||||
|
||||
Clear out the default :icon:`fa-filter` :guilabel:`Apps` filter, then type the name of the desired
|
||||
country into the search bar. All available modules for that country are presented.
|
||||
|
||||
.. example::
|
||||
Some countries only have one localization module, while other have multiple modules. This is
|
||||
typically when other software is neede to process payroll, and importing and exporting data is
|
||||
required.
|
||||
|
||||
For example. when searching for **Payroll** modules for `Egypt`, the following modules appear in
|
||||
the search, and must be installed: `Egypt - Payroll` and `Egypt - Payroll with Accounting`.
|
||||
|
||||
Refer to the :ref:`country-specific documentation <payroll_localizations/countries-list>` for a
|
||||
complete list of the related **Payroll** modules required for each specific country.
|
||||
|
||||
.. tip::
|
||||
To see if any localization modules have been installed on the database, navigate to
|
||||
:menuselection:`Payroll app --> Configuration --> Settings`. In the :guilabel:`Settings` page, if
|
||||
a localization module was installed, a :guilabel:`(Country) Localization` section appears.
|
